You are here

public function RouteCompilerTest::testGetFit in Drupal 8

Same name and namespace in other branches
  1. 9 core/tests/Drupal/Tests/Core/Routing/RouteCompilerTest.php \Drupal\Tests\Core\Routing\RouteCompilerTest::testGetFit()
  2. 10 core/tests/Drupal/Tests/Core/Routing/RouteCompilerTest.php \Drupal\Tests\Core\Routing\RouteCompilerTest::testGetFit()

Tests RouteCompiler::getFit().

@dataProvider providerTestGetFit

Parameters

string $path: A path whose fit will be calculated in the test.

int $expected: The expected fit returned by RouteCompiler::getFit()

File

core/tests/Drupal/Tests/Core/Routing/RouteCompilerTest.php, line 26

Class

RouteCompilerTest
@coversDefaultClass \Drupal\Core\Routing\RouteCompiler @group Routing

Namespace

Drupal\Tests\Core\Routing

Code

public function testGetFit($path, $expected) {
  $route_compiler = new RouteCompiler();
  $result = $route_compiler
    ->getFit($path);
  $this
    ->assertSame($expected, $result);
}